How it works

Sri Lanka uses a 10-digit open numbering plan published by the Telecommunications Regulatory Commission of Sri Lanka (TRCSL). A geographic (landline) number is made of three parts dialled back to back:

  1. The national trunk prefix 0, dialled before any domestic call.
  2. A 2-digit area code (AA) that identifies the region — 11 for Colombo, 81 for Kandy, 91 for Galle.
  3. A 7-digit subscriber number (nnnnnnn) assigned by the exchange.

Put together, a domestic number is 0 AA nnnnnnn — exactly 10 digits, for example 081 234 5678. To convert to international form the finder follows ITU-T Recommendation E.164: drop the national trunk 0, prepend the country code +94, and keep the remaining 9-digit national significant number. So 081 234 5678 becomes +94 81 234 5678 and, compacted to E.164, +94812345678.

When you type letters, the tool runs a place-to-code lookup across a curated table of city names, districts, nearby towns, and common spelling variants, with a small fuzzy tolerance so galla still finds Galle. When you type digits, it strips spaces, hyphens, brackets, and any +94, 0094, or trunk 0, then reads the first two digits of the national number as the area code. Numbers in the 07Xrange are recognised as mobile — which, under Sri Lanka's number portability, map to no fixed region — and short codes such as 1919 are flagged as out of scope. Worked examples

Place lookup — Colombo

Colombo

  1. Query is letters → place-to-code lookup.
  2. Match: Colombo → area code 11.
  3. Domestic dial code: 0 + 11 = 011.
  4. International code: +94 11.
  5. A sample line 011 234 5678 → +94 11 234 5678 → E.164 +94112345678.
  6. Digit check: 0 (1) + 11 (2) + 2345678 (7) = 10 national digits. ✓

Reverse number lookup — Ratnapura freelancer

045 222 3344

  1. Query is digits → number lookup.
  2. Strip trunk 0 → national number 45 222 3344 (9 digits).
  3. First two digits 45 → Ratnapura (Sabaragamuwa Province).
  4. Local: 045 222 3344.
  5. International: +94 45 222 3344 → E.164 +94452223344.
  6. This is the form to put on an Upwork or invoice contact field. ✓

Edge case — mobile number rejected

077 123 4567

  1. Strip trunk 0 → national number 771234567.
  2. First digit is 7 → this is the 07X mobile range.
  3. Mobile numbers aren't tied to a region, so no district is invented.
  4. Because of number portability, the 07X prefix no longer names the operator either.
  5. Result: “This is a mobile number, not a landline area code.” ✓

All Sri Lankan landline area codes (29)

Every geographic area code in the national numbering plan, sorted by code. The 0-prefixed form is what you dial inside Sri Lanka; the +94 form is what you publish for international callers.

LocalIntlCityDistrict
011+94 11ColomboColombo
021+94 21JaffnaJaffna
023+94 23MannarMannar
024+94 24VavuniyaVavuniya
025+94 25AnuradhapuraAnuradhapura
026+94 26TrincomaleeTrincomalee
027+94 27PolonnaruwaPolonnaruwa
031+94 31NegomboGampaha
032+94 32ChilawPuttalam
033+94 33GampahaGampaha
034+94 34KalutaraKalutara
035+94 35KegalleKegalle
036+94 36AvissawellaColombo
037+94 37KurunegalaKurunegala
038+94 38PanaduraKalutara
041+94 41MataraMatara
045+94 45RatnapuraRatnapura
047+94 47HambantotaHambantota
051+94 51HattonNuwara Eliya
052+94 52Nuwara EliyaNuwara Eliya
054+94 54NawalapitiyaKandy
055+94 55BadullaBadulla
057+94 57BandarawelaBadulla
063+94 63AmparaAmpara
065+94 65BatticaloaBatticaloa
066+94 66MataleMatale
067+94 67KalmunaiAmpara
081+94 81KandyKandy
091+94 91GalleGalle
